/* * zipl - zSeries Initial Program Loader tool * * Subroutines for ECKD disks * * Copyright IBM Corp. 2013, 2017 * * s390-tools is free software; you can redistribute it and/or modify * it under the terms of the MIT license. See LICENSE for details. */ #include "eckd.h" #include "s390.h" #include "stage2.h" int extract_length(void *data) { struct eckd_blockptr *blockptr = (struct eckd_blockptr *)data; return blockptr->size * (blockptr->blockct + 1); } int is_zero_block(void *data) { struct eckd_blockptr *blockptr = (struct eckd_blockptr *)data; return blockptr->cyl || blockptr->head || blockptr->sec; } void * load_direct(disk_blockptr_t *data, struct subchannel_id subchannel_id, void *load_addr) { struct eckd_blockptr *blockptr = (struct eckd_blockptr *)data; struct ccw1 *ccws; unsigned long record_size; struct seek_arg seek_addr; struct chr_t search_arg; int record_number; struct irb *irb; struct orb orb; int i = 3; irb = (struct irb *)&S390_lowcore.irb; memset(irb, 0, sizeof(struct irb)); memset(&orb, 0, sizeof(struct orb)); memset(&seek_addr, 0, sizeof(struct ch_t)); memset(&search_arg, 0, sizeof(struct chr_t)); ccws = (struct ccw1 *)get_zeroed_page(); /* initialise SEEK, SEARCH and TIC CCW*/ ccws[0].cmd_code = DASD_ECKD_CCW_SEEK; ccws[0].flags = CCW_FLAG_CC | CCW_FLAG_SLI; ccws[0].count = 6; seek_addr.ch.cyl = blockptr->cyl; seek_addr.ch.head = blockptr->head; ccws[0].cda = (uint32_t) (unsigned long) &seek_addr; record_number = blockptr->blockct; record_size = blockptr->size; ccws[1].cmd_code = DASD_ECKD_CCW_SEARCH; ccws[1].flags = CCW_FLAG_CC | CCW_FLAG_SLI; ccws[1].count = 5; search_arg.cyl = blockptr->cyl; search_arg.head = blockptr->head; search_arg.record = blockptr->sec; ccws[1].cda = (uint32_t) (unsigned long) &search_arg; ccws[2].cmd_code = DASD_ECKD_CCW_TIC; ccws[2].flags = 0; ccws[2].count = 0; ccws[2].cda = (uint32_t) (unsigned long) &ccws[1]; /* initialise READ CCWs */ while (1) { ccws[i].cmd_code = DASD_ECKD_CCW_READ_MT; ccws[i].flags = CCW_FLAG_SLI; ccws[i].count = record_size; ccws[i].cda = (uint32_t) (unsigned long) load_addr; record_number--; load_addr += record_size; i++; if (record_number >= 0) ccws[i-1].flags |= CCW_FLAG_CC; else break; } orb.fmt = 1; orb.cpa = (uint32_t) (unsigned long) ccws; start_io(subchannel_id, irb, &orb, 1); free_page((unsigned long)ccws); return load_addr; }
